¿Cuáles son los primeros pasos para implementar el reemplazo de una aplicación de escritorio de Windows por una web?
Reemplazar una aplicación de escritorio de Windows por una solución web no es un simple cambio tecnológico; es una decisión estratégica que afecta la operativa diaria, la seguridad y la escalabilidad del negocio. Para que la transición sea exitosa, conviene abordarla con un plan estructurado que minimice riesgos y maximice el retorno de inversión. A continuación se detallan los pasos fundamentales que cualquier equipo directivo o técnico debería considerar antes de embarcarse en este tipo de proyecto.
El primer paso consiste en realizar un diagnóstico profundo de la aplicación actual y del contexto de uso. No se trata solo de listar funcionalidades, sino de entender los flujos de trabajo reales, las dependencias con otros sistemas, los volúmenes de datos y las restricciones operativas. Por ejemplo, si la aplicación de escritorio gestiona información crítica de clientes o procesos financieros, será necesario evaluar requisitos de ciberseguridad y cumplimiento normativo desde el inicio. En esta fase, Q2BSTUDIO suele colaborar con los equipos internos para mapear cada proceso y definir indicadores base que permitan medir el impacto de la migración.
Una vez que se tiene claridad sobre el alcance y los objetivos, el siguiente paso es definir la arquitectura técnica de la nueva aplicación web. Aquí entran en juego decisiones sobre la plataforma cloud: servicios cloud aws y azure ofrecen escalabilidad, pero la elección depende de factores como la ubicación de los datos, la integración con herramientas existentes y el presupuesto. También es el momento de plantear si se incorporarán capacidades de inteligencia artificial para automatizar tareas repetitivas o generar insights a partir de los datos. Por ejemplo, se pueden diseñar agentes IA que asistan a los usuarios en tiempo real o sistemas de recomendación basados en el historial de uso. Empresas como Q2BSTUDIO integran módulos de ia para empresas de forma modular, permitiendo añadirlos progresivamente sin comprometer la estabilidad del sistema.
La planificación del desarrollo debe adoptar un enfoque iterativo con entregas tempranas. Un error común es querer replicar todas las funcionalidades de la aplicación de escritorio en la primera versión web. Es mucho más efectivo priorizar un producto mínimo viable (MVP) que cubra las operaciones críticas y permita a los usuarios probar la nueva plataforma cuanto antes. Durante esta etapa, Q2BSTUDIO recomienda establecer canales de feedback continuo y realizar pruebas de integración con sistemas legacy como ERPs, CRMs o bases de datos locales. Para garantizar la seguridad en la comunicación entre la web y los sistemas on-premise, se suelen implementar túneles VPN o conexiones seguras a través de servicios cloud aws y azure, minimizando riesgos de exposición.
Paralelamente al desarrollo, es necesario preparar la estrategia de migración de datos. Si la aplicación de escritorio almacena información en formatos como Access, Excel o SQL Server local, se debe planificar una limpieza, transformación y carga controlada. Aquí la inteligencia de negocio juega un rol clave: contar con dashboards y reportes (por ejemplo, con power bi) que permitan visualizar el estado de la migración y validar la integridad de los datos tras cada fase. Q2BSTUDIO suele incluir en sus entregas paneles de control personalizados que facilitan a directivos y analistas monitorear el progreso y detectar anomalías de forma inmediata.
La capacitación y la gestión del cambio son aspectos igual de relevantes que la tecnología. Los usuarios que han trabajado durante años con una interfaz de escritorio pueden mostrar resistencia ante una plataforma web, especialmente si cambian flujos de trabajo o atajos de teclado. Es recomendable diseñar sesiones formativas prácticas, crear documentación contextual y designar embajadores internos que apoyen la transición. Además, conviene mantener la aplicación de escritorio disponible durante un período de solapamiento para que los equipos puedan adaptarse sin presiones.
Finalmente, una vez que la aplicación web está operativa, el ciclo no termina. La monitorización continua de rendimiento, seguridad y uso permite identificar oportunidades de mejora. Aquí es donde el software a medida demuestra su valor: al ser desarrollado específicamente para las necesidades de la empresa, es más fácil añadir funcionalidades o ajustar procesos sin depender de actualizaciones de terceros. Q2BSTUDIO ofrece servicios de soporte evolutivo y optimización basada en métricas reales, asegurando que la inversión siga generando beneficios a largo plazo.
En resumen, migrar de una aplicación de escritorio de Windows a una web implica mucho más que cambiar la interfaz: es una oportunidad para repensar procesos, integrar aplicaciones a medida con capacidades de inteligencia artificial y fortalecer la ciberseguridad y la escalabilidad del negocio. Dar los pasos adecuados desde el diagnóstico hasta la puesta en producción marca la diferencia entre un proyecto que genera valor y uno que se convierte en un lastre técnico. Si tu organización está evaluando este camino, contar con un partner que combine experiencia en servicios cloud aws y azure, desarrollo de aplicaciones a medida e ia para empresas puede acelerar significativamente los resultados y reducir los riesgos asociados a la transformación digital.
Comentarios